Output e39aaf0fa3649c272a662f6b9c736dc1cb5341a77ffa19a196418fc0be7f64c6:17

value
51713898
script pubkey
OP_0 OP_PUSHBYTES_32 e74803b624866dbd479b24e7c4e7fd78e5a6f86bbb6889adab93d6a50073df26
address
bc1quayq8d3ysekm63umynnufela0rj6d7rthd5gntdtj0t22qrnmunq2z785a
transaction
e39aaf0fa3649c272a662f6b9c736dc1cb5341a77ffa19a196418fc0be7f64c6
spent
true